Well-Being

The experience of health, happiness, and prosperity.  It includes having good mental health, high life satisfaction, a sense of meaning or purpose, and the ability to manage stress.

Introspection

•Introspection is the examination or observation of one’s own mental and emotional processes. Through introspection, we can gain knowledge about our inner workings.

•Introspection is sort of like perception, but also unlike perception in that it doesn’t involve the five senses.  We don’t see, hear, smell, touch, or taste, to gain insights.

•Introspection involves looking inward to try to understand ourselves.
